<span>Mature tRNA has an amino acid binding site at one end and the other end interacts with the mRNA by complementary base pairing due to the presence of an anticodon. An anticodon is a three nucleotide sequence which is complementary to the triplet codon of mRNA which specifies a protein for synthesis.</span>

Explanation: Kinetic energy is directly proportional to temperature, thus as temperature decreases, kinetic energy also decreases.

Gas is the state of matter in which particles are very loosely bound and hence can easily move past one another very easily and have highest kinetic energy.

Liquid is the state of matter in which particles are loosely bound and hence can move past one another easily and have high kinetic energy.

Solid is the state of matter in which particles are tightly bound and hence can not move easily and have low kinetic energy.

Thus on moving from gaseous to solid state, the kinetic energy decreases and the molecules get closer together.
